The Sponsored Research Office (SRO) supports faculty and professional research staff in their efforts to secure and ensure proper stewardship of external funding.
The office is responsible for the effective and timely handling of research proposals, specifically for preparing, interpreting, submission, and accepting agreements on behalf of Occidental College for projects and programs funded by federal and state agencies, foundations, and other public and private sources.
Occidental College is a federally recognized Emerging Research Institution (ERI).
Proposals
You're interested in applying for a sponsored project, now what? SRO is here to support you in preparing proposals for external funding opportunities. From evaluating eligibility for a solicitation to budget development, SRO can assist along the way. Once you have identified a funding opportunity you are interested in, you must submit an Intent to Submit Form (ISF) to SRO no later than ten (10) business days before the proposal is due to the sponsor. All Oxy faculty and staff can find the pre-award resources you will need on the myOxy portal on the Sponsored Research page, including the link to the ISF.
Equipment
The Sponsored Research Office carries out the College’s obligation to track capital equipment purchased with federal funds (2 CFR 200.313). Per the College’s Equipment and Property Policy, equipment that costs $5,000 or greater (Oxy’s capitalization threshold) and is funded by a federal or non-federal grant, contract, or cooperative agreement must be logged, tagged, and monitored.
Principal Investigators/Project Directors (PIs/PDs) must notify SRO once their equipment or property has been delivered to take an initial inventory and accordingly tag the equipment or property. Additionally, the College is required to take a physical inventory of all equipment and property purchased with federal and non-federal funds. SRO will reach out to PIs/PDs to coordinate lab visits to verify the condition and location of all sponsored project assets..
Please note that PIs/PDs must not dispose of, transfer, or sell any equipment or property purchased with sponsored funds, without prior written request to and approval from SRO, and if required by the terms and conditions of the award, the sponsoring entity.
